How Technology Improves Healthcare for Mexican Elders

Access to technology is more than just a luxury; it’s a lifeline for elderly Mexicans when it comes to managing their health. With tools like telemedicine, health apps, and wearable devices, older adults can track their conditions, consult with doctors remotely, and stay on top of their medication—all without leaving their homes. For Mexican elders, this access means fewer trips to crowded clinics and more time spent doing what they love, whether it’s gardening or sharing stories with family.

Breaking the Barrier: Digital Literacy for Elders

Now, let's be real: not every elder is a tech wizard. But that’s where digital literacy programs come in. These programs teach elders how to use the internet, apps, and devices to improve their lives. By learning how to schedule medical appointments, check symptoms, or even chat with doctors online, older adults can take charge of their health in ways that were once unimaginable.
